What makes you think those are ports are from Norton? The 1900 port is for UPnP SSDP. And the others are dynamic ports for data connections. Could be as simple as Internet Explorer or Firefox receiving HTTP data. Port numbers between 49152 and 65535 are dynamic, for unregistered services and temporary connections (most for this).

Port 1110 appears to be a NFS (Network File System) connection.
